UP CM Yogi Adityanath distributes flats to 72 EWS beneficiaries on land reclaimed from mafia-politician Mukhtar Ansari in Lucknow under the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el Housing Scheme.
Uttar Pradesh CM Yogi Adityanath on Wednesday handed over flats to 72 beneficiaries from the Economic Weaker Section (EWS), built on land recovered from the illegal possession of mafia-turned-politician Mukhtar Ansari in Dalibagh, Lucknow. The key distribution ceremony was held at Ekta Van, opposite the Director General of Police’s residence.
During the event, CM Yogi Adityanath personally handed over keys to 10 allottees. The flats, constructed under the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el Housing Scheme, are valued at Rs 10.70 lakh each. The lottery for allotment was completed on Tuesday, according to officials.

Lucknow Development Authority (LDA) Vice-Chairman Prathamesh Kumar stated that the project reflects the CM’s strict anti-mafia stance. The reclaimed land of approximately 2,322 square meters was used to build three G+3 blocks, housing 72 flats, each measuring 36.65 square meters. The online registration for the scheme, open from October 4 to November 3, received nearly 8,000 applications.
Mukhtar Ansari, 63, a five-time MLA from Mau Sadar and a jailed gangster-turned-politician, passed away on March 28, 2024, due to cardiac arrest in Banda, Uttar Pradesh. Ansari faced over 60 criminal cases, with convictions in eight cases by September 2022, and was serving sentences in UP and Punjab.
This housing initiative showcases the Uttar Pradesh government’s commitment to providing homes to EWS beneficiaries while reclaiming illegally occupied land from criminal elements.
